Trusted since 2008
Chat on WhatsApp

📘 Access 10,000+ CBC Exams With Marking Schemes

Prepare your learners for success! Get CBC-aligned exams for Grades 1–9, PP1–PP2, Playgroup and High School - all with marking schemes.

Browse Exams

Instant download • Trusted by 100,000+ teachers • Updated weekly

Past Examinations Question Papers in Kenya

Find past years question papers for universities, colleges and schools in Kenya. Our online database contains many past papers which will assist you in preparing for examinations. Get KCPE, KCSE, KNEC, KASNEB, CPA, ATC, ACCA past papers here.
You can also share your past papers with others by posting using the link below.

Primary and High School Exams With Marking Schemes

Exams With Marking Schemes

End Term 3 Exams

Mid Term Exams

End Term 1 Exams

End Term 3 Exams

Opener Exams

Full Set Exams


Search for Question Papers:

Post a past paper


Search Results...
Sch2107:Inorganic Chemistry
Ics2110;Information Technology I
Abe2321:Horticultural Structure
Sbt2102:General Microbiology
Sbt2102:General Microbiology
Sbt2102:General Microbiology
Hrd2103:General Economics
Hrd2103:General Economics
Szl2110:Entomology
Szl2110:Entomology
Ahs2103;Animal Production
Ahs2103;Animal Production
Aha2101:Agriculture And Agrometeology
Bcs 112 Introduction To World Civilization 1
Hrmg_432_-_Career_Development
Nrsg_330_Community_Health_Ii
Nrsg_324_Paediatric_Nursing-
Hsci_107_Human_Anatomy_111
Hsci_105_Human_Anatomy
Hsci_104_Clinical_Nutrition_And_Dietetics
Buss 219: Managerial Accounting
Bbit 437:Accounting Information Systems
Bbit 437:Accounting Information Systems
Hist 012/105: Introduction To History
Bhtm 308 Accommodation Operations Management
Comp 100: Computer Applications
Comp 100: Computer Applications
Comp 100: Computer Applications
Comp 100: Computer Applications
Comp 100: Computer Applications